Are you talking about removing rust from bolts or removing a rusty bolt? If you are talking about removing a bolt that is rusty and seized in then you probably want to try Croil. I don't know if I spelled it right Sam would know. That is like super penetrating oil. If you just want it to look pretty then I guess its Naval Jelly.
